Post 9/11, the Markets Fought Back Amid Grieving
Twenty-five years ago today, an evil tragedy struck, but a nation persevered. We will never forget what happened that sunny Tuesday, when black smoke from the Twin Towers darkened the sky. But we also celebrate how America’s society, economy and markets charged on as the great, everyday people of our nation linked arms and vowed to carry on. After quickly registering society’s shock and fear, markets fought back even while the nation was still grieving. That same gumption and free-market system propel our economy and stocks today, no matter how much naysaying you might hear on podcasts, social media, radio and cable.
